Title: The Innovative Contributions of John Ryan Goodfellow

Introduction

John Ryan Goodfellow, based in Mesa, Arizona, is a notable inventor recognized for his contributions in the field of electrical engineering. With a remarkable portfolio of six patents, Goodfellow has pioneered advancements in power regulation technologies. His innovations primarily focus on improving the performance and reliability of Pulse Width Modulation (PWM) converters and switching power regulators.

Latest Patents

Goodfellow's recent patents showcase his deep expertise in fault recovery mechanisms for PWM converters. One of his latest patents, titled "Dynamic Enhancement of Loop Response Upon Recovery from Fault Conditions," outlines a sophisticated method that detects fault conditions in PWM converters. The approach involves sampling the peak voltage, which is proportional to the sensed current through a transistor, and adjusting the error output of an error amplifier to drive the transistor effectively. This innovation ensures that the output load can return to the programmed output voltage seamlessly following an input voltage fluctuation.

His other notable invention, "Switching Power Regulator and Method for Recovering the Switching Power Regulator from an Unregulated State," elaborates on a regulator that efficiently manages the transition from an unregulated state while minimizing the risk of output voltage overshoot. This patent includes components such as a dropout detector and soft start circuit, providing a reliable solution to voltage regulation challenges.
